What to Expect
Expect a sharp, paved but steep 3.5 km trek starting from the meadows of Chopta. The weather can flip from scorching sun to a freezing snowstorm in 20 minutes. You'll find basic dhabas along the way selling Maggi, chai, and parathas, but luxury is non-existent here. Expect a deeply spiritual vibe mixed with the chaos of enthusiastic trekkers, panting mules, and ringing temple bells.
- Altitude sickness (AMS) is real here; do not rush the ascent from Chopta.
- Washroom facilities are basic to non-existent on the trail—prepare to rough it.
- The temple shrine is closed in winter (Nov-April) and the idol is moved to Makku Math.
- BSNL and Jio work sporadically; do not rely on UPI, carry enough cash.
- Weekend crowds in May and June are overwhelming, causing massive traffic jams on the Chopta road.

Plan Your Trip
Take an overnight bus or train from Delhi to Haridwar or Rishikesh. From there, hire a direct taxi or take a shared local bus to Ukhimath, then another taxi to Chopta. The Tungnath trek starts directly from the Chopta roadhead.
Local Guide
Must try: Pahari Maggi, Aloo Paratha with local pickle, Buransh (Rhododendron) Juice, Dal Bhat (Rice and Lentils)
Eat at the small dhabas along the trail. The food is basic but hot and fresh. Keep in mind that prices for simple items like Maggi or chai double as you go higher due to the cost of transporting goods via mules.
